How to Select a Secure Lock for Front Door

How to Select a Secure Lock for Front Door

Filed Under: home improvement

Your front door helps to keep your home secure, protecting both your family and belongings against intruders. To maximize security, you must ensure to install the right locks. However, there are several types of front door locks out there; so, choosing the right one might prove a daunting task.

Here’s how to select a secure lock for front door.

Door Material

One of the crucial things to consider when selecting a door lock is the type of material. Front doors can be made of wood, uPVC, composite, steel, or aluminum. Consequently, each door requires specific locks, and you must ensure to get the right one for yours.

Door Frame

Often, people overlook their door framing when installing locks, and this could prove dangerous. If you attach a lock to a flimsy frame, then burglars can easily access your home. You must ensure that your door’s frames are sturdy enough to withstand a significant amount of brutal force.

Door Style

When choosing your front door locks, you must also factor in their style. You want to get a door lock whose aesthetics match your door and home.

Door rating

Different front doors have different security ratings. Therefore, when selecting a lock, you need to ensure that it matches your door’s security rating. The rating determines the amount of force the door can withstand in case someone tries to gain access forcefully.

Door Size

Additionally, you must consider your front door’s size before selecting a lock. The positioning of the lock determines the security of the front door, and it also contributes to your home’s aesthetics. You want to get a lock that’ll function effectively.

Types of Front Door Locks

Smart Locks

Front door digital locks are some of the most popular options out there. Such locks don’t need a key to open. Instead, they feature a numeric keypad, while others are controlled remotely using a smartphone app. With such doors, you don’t have to worry about misplacing your keys. They also give you seamless control of your front door.

Multi-Point Locking System

Multi-point locking systems are great for front doors. And they are usually operated using keys. Such locks are installed into your door’s body, and they require from three to five points to get locked directly into your door frame, enhancing security.

Five-Lever Mortice Deadlock

Such locks are suitable for wooden front doors. They are usually fitted into your door instead of its surface. They work effectively because they get locked from both the inside and the outside.

Lever Lock

You can also get a front door lever lock, which features three- or five-point options. The level of security on such locks is determined by the number of levers each has – the higher the better. You can operate these locks from both the inside and outside.

Conclusion

Your front door is the main access point to your house. As such, it needs to be secure and capable of keeping unauthorized people out. If you are using secure locks to protect your home, ensure it compliments your front door’s style, frame, material, and style.
